Sounds like a blown head gasket to me, the muffler may just be coincidence.
You're getting oil in your coolant and it's turning brown and overflowing (either from overheating again or from pressure from the cylinders getting past the head gasket into the coolant passages)

It's a blown headgasket like mentioned above. Same thing happen 2 mine n when i would give it gas the overflow tank would expand. But dont start the car until it's fixed. Replace the headgasket n get the head resurfaced even if it's not warped just 2 b on the safe side.
